Summary[edit | edit source]

  • organism: Staphylococcus aureus USA300_FPR3757
  • locus tag: SAUSA300_pUSA030028 [new locus tag: SAUSA300_RS14875 ]
  • pan locus tag?:
  • symbol: SAUSA300_pUSA030028
  • pan gene symbol?:
  • synonym:
  • product: resolvase

Genome View[edit | edit source]

Gene[edit | edit source]

General[edit | edit source]

  • type: CDS
  • locus tag: SAUSA300_pUSA030028 [new locus tag: SAUSA300_RS14875 ]
  • symbol: SAUSA300_pUSA030028
  • product: resolvase
  • replicon: pUSA03
  • strand: +
  • coordinates: 26735..27367
  • length: 633
  • essential: unknown

Protein[edit | edit source]

General[edit | edit source]

  • locus tag: SAUSA300_pUSA030028 [new locus tag: SAUSA300_RS14875 ]
  • symbol: SAUSA300_pUSA030028
  • description: resolvase
  • length: 210
  • theoretical pI: 9.71682
  • theoretical MW: 24442.1
  • GRAVY: -0.534762
